Place all Bills and Changes to Bills in a Public Git Repository

The Issue

Version Control Software, such as git, is used by software developers to manage large numbers of complicated revisions to enormous code-bases from complete strangers.

One of the more powerful features of version control software is to perform a "diff": Literally, to see what is different between any two stages of a document.

We, the undersigned, ask that Congress adopt a public git repository for all bills (passed, tabled, or pending a vote) and that all revisions to bills be publicly logged and attributed.

The end result of this proposal should be the following:

1. Our representatives will be able to actually read these proposed changes.
2. A more transparent government.

Specific platforms worth considering incude: GitLab, GitHub, and PenFlip. Please don't use something obscure like bzr or ancient like CVS.
